The 22nd International Swiss Cup 2017 hosted Swiss and French teams at the Locanet Arena in Burgdorf. More than 20 teams competed on Saturday in seven different categories.
The city of Neuchâtel, in Switzerland, hosted an intense synchro skating competition day. Countries as Finland, Canada, United States of America, France, Germany or Italy were represented. This international event also represented for the Swiss teams their National Championships.
Switzerland lived this Saturday his first competition in Zuchwil (canton of Solothurn). Twenty-two teams from the whole country present their work and their new programs for the first time. Junior ISU, Advanced Novice, Basic Novice, Mixed Age, Senior non ISU, and Adults were represented.
